Softened butter is key
When it comes to baking cookies, the temperature of your butter plays a significant role in the final texture and spread. For this recipe, using softened butter is absolutely crucial. Softened butter, which means it’s pliable but still cool to the touch, creams beautifully with sugar, creating tiny air pockets that contribute to a light and fluffy cookie dough. If your butter is too cold, it won’t cream properly, resulting in dense cookies. If it’s too warm or melted, the dough will be greasy, and the cookies might spread too much and become flat. A good test for softened butter is if you can easily make an indentation with your finger without it melting. Plan ahead by taking your butter out of the refrigerator about 30-60 minutes before you start baking.

Creaming butter and sugars
The first step in creating your cookie dough base is creaming butter and sugars together. In a large bowl, using an electric mixer, beat the softened butter with both granulated and brown sugars until the mixture is light, fluffy, and pale in color. This process typically takes about 2-3 minutes. Creaming is crucial because it incorporates air into the butter and sugar mixture, which contributes to the cookies’ light texture and helps them rise. The sugar crystals cut into the butter, creating tiny pockets that trap air. This trapped air expands during baking, resulting in a tender, softer cookie crumb. Don’t rush this step, as it significantly impacts the final cookie structure. Once adequately creamed, beat in the eggs one at a time, followed by the vanilla extract, ensuring each addition is fully incorporated before adding the next.
Wet and dry components
After you’ve successfully creamed the butter, sugars, and wet ingredients, it’s time to combine them with the dry components. In a separate bowl, whisk together your all-purpose flour, baking soda, and salt. This pre-mixing of dry ingredients ensures that the leavening agent (baking soda) and salt are evenly distributed throughout the flour, preventing pockets of uneven flavor or rise in your cookies. Gradually add the dry ingredient mixture to the wet mixture, mixing on low speed until just combined. It’s essential not to overmix at this stage; overmixing develops the gluten in the flour, which can lead to tough, dense cookies. Stop mixing as soon as no dry streaks of flour are visible. A slightly shaggy dough is perfectly acceptable and often preferable, as the final additions will complete the mixing process without overworking the flour. Preheat oven to 350°F
Before you even think about scooping dough onto a baking sheet, it’s absolutely essential to pre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Allowing your oven to fully reach and maintain this temperature ensures that your cookies bake evenly and correctly. Placing dough into a cold or insufficiently preheated oven can lead to cookies that spread too much, bake unevenly, or don’t achieve the desired texture. An oven thermometer can be a great tool to verify your oven’s accuracy. This precise temperature is ideal for cookie baking, providing enough heat to set the edges while allowing the center to remain soft and gooey. Drop dough on parchment
Once your oven is properly preheated, prepare your baking sheets. Lining them with parchment paper or silicone baking mats is highly recommended. This prevents sticking, promotes even baking, and makes cleanup a breeze. Using a cookie scoop (about 1.5-2 tablespoons) or two spoons, drop dough on parchment-lined baking sheets, leaving about 2 inches of space between each cookie. This spacing is important because the cookies will spread as they bake. Avoid overcrowding the baking sheet, as this can lead to uneven baking and cookies that stick together. If you’re using a scoop, slightly flatten the top of each dough ball just a bit to encourage a more uniform spread and shape during baking. This careful placement ensures each cookie gets its fair share of oven heat.

Bake 9-11 minutes
Once your dough is scooped and your oven is hot, it’s time to bake! Place the baking sheets in the preheated oven and bake 9-11 minutes. Baking time can vary slightly depending on your oven’s calibration and how large you scooped your cookies. Keep a close eye on them, especially towards the end of the baking cycle. You’re looking for cookies that are set around the edges and beginning to turn a light golden brown. The centers might still look a little soft and underbaked, but that’s perfectly normal and desired for a chewy interior. Overbaking will result in dry, hard cookies that lose their wonderful texture. If you like a slightly crispier cookie, you can bake for the full 11 minutes or even a minute longer, but always err on the side of underbaking for chewiness.
Cool before moving cookies
This step is often overlooked but is absolutely vital for the structural integrity and texture of your freshly baked cookies. Once the cookies are out of the oven, do not immediately attempt to transfer them to a cooling rack. Instead, let them cool before moving cookies, allowing them to rest on the baking sheet for about 5-10 minutes. During this crucial resting period, the cookies continue to bake slightly from the residual heat of the pan, and they firm up significantly. If you try to move them too soon, they will likely break apart due to their delicate, warm state. After they’ve rested on the baking sheet, gently trans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ely. This full cooling process is essential for achieving that ideal chewy texture and crisp edges, making them ready to enjoy.

Chill dough for more flavor
While this recipe is designed for quick baking, an often-recommended “secret weapon” for truly flavorful cookies is to chill dough for more flavor. If you have the time, covering the cookie dough and refrigerating it for at least 30 minutes, or even overnight, can significantly deepen the flavors and improve the texture. Chilling allows the flour to fully hydrate, which leads to a more tender and evenly baked cookie. It also gives the flavors a chance to meld and intensify, resulting in a richer, more complex taste. Furthermore, cold dough spreads less in the oven, leading to thicker, chewier cookies. This is a common baking technique used by professional bakers to enhance the quality of their creations.

Use gluten-free flour
The primary adjustment for making these cookies gluten-free is to use gluten-free flour. Opt for a good quality 1:1 gluten-free baking flour blend that contains xanthan gum (or add a small amount if your blend doesn’t include it). These blends are specifically formulated to substitute traditional all-purpose flour in baking recipes, often yielding excellent results with minimal changes to the original recipe. Measure the gluten-free flour by weight if possible, as it can sometimes be denser than regular flour. The rest of the baking process—creaming butter and sugar, adding wet and dry ingredients, and folding in chips and Krispies—remains largely the same, ensuring a familiar and straightforward baking experience. Check all other ingredients
While switching to gluten-free flour is the biggest step, it’s also crucial to check all other ingredients to ensure they are certified gluten-free. Most common cookie ingredients like sugar, eggs, butter, vanilla extract, baking soda, and salt are naturally gluten-free. However, it’s particularly important to verify your chocolate chips and, especially, your Rice Krispies cereal. Some brands of Rice Krispies may contain malt flavoring derived from barley, which contains gluten. Always look for brands that explicitly state “gluten-free” on their packaging to avoid any hidden gluten. Taking this extra step guarantees that your delicious gluten-free cookies are safe for everyone to enjoy without concern, providing peace of mind along with fantastic flavor.

Airtight container storage
To keep your freshly baked chocolate rice krispies cookies at their best for short-term enjoyment, airtight container storage is essential. Once the cookies have cooled completely to room temperature (this is very important to prevent condensation), place them in an airtight container. A cookie jar with a tight-fitting lid, a plastic food storage container, or a resealable bag will work perfectly. Storing them in an airtight environment prevents them from drying out and helps maintain that desired balance of crispiness and chewiness. They will typically stay fresh and delightful for 3-5 days when stored this way on the counter at room temperature. For an extra touch, you can place a slice of bread in the container to help absorb excess moisture and keep them soft.
Freeze for long freshness
If you’ve baked a large batch or want to enjoy your delicious treats weeks or even months down the line, you can freeze for long freshness. Once the cookies are completely cool, arrange them in a single layer on a baking sheet and flash freeze them for about 30 minutes to an hour. This step prevents them from sticking together when transferred to a larger container. After flash freezing, transfer the hardened cookies to a freezer-safe airtight container or a heavy-duty freezer bag, separating layers with parchment paper if stacking. Frozen cookies can maintain their quality for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y them, simply take out the desired number and let them thaw at room temperature for about 15-30 minutes. You can even warm them slightly in the microwave or oven for that fresh-baked feel.
